Abstract

See full text

This invention is a process for producing metal strip resistors, i.e., forming the two electrodes at the two ends of an metal strip with thick electroplating and laying a layer of coating on the surface of the metal strip for heat radiation (a metal cooling plate may be pasted onto the coating when necessary). The producing procedures include rolling, punching, electroplating, cutting, grooving, coating, fixing the cooling plate, and drying. The finished product is the metal strip resistor described in this invention. The said electrode production method can maximize the contact surface between the electrodes and the base strip to pass more current and decrease the resistance valve (usually to 0.0001 ohm). The heat ventilating plate on the base strip can facilitate heat emission to stabilize the resistance valve and enhance its capacity.
